Our Distinctive Kindergarten Curriculum
At Reach Academy, kindergarten students experience learning through our comprehensive A.C.E. (Accelerated Christian Education) curriculum, which is designed to build skill upon skill at each child's individual pace.
Faith-Integrated Learning
Our kindergarten program integrates biblical principles throughout each subject area:
- Phonics-Based Reading - Students develop strong literacy foundations through a systematic approach to phonics instruction
- Mathematics - Children develop number sense and problem-solving skills through hands-on activities and real-world applications
- Bible Study - Daily Bible lessons help children understand God's Word at their level and apply biblical principles to daily life
- Science Exploration - Students discover God's creation through age-appropriate experiments and observations
- Social Studies - Children learn about communities, geography, and history from a Christian perspective
- Art and Music - Creative expression is encouraged through various media and musical experiences
The A.C.E. program moves with continuous progress, allowing children to advance rapidly in areas of strength while taking necessary time to master challenging concepts. As our site explains: "Each student learns essential academics and explores truths about God and His world without pressure to keep up with a group."

Frequently Asked Questions About Our Kindergarten Program
What age requirements does my child need to meet for kindergarten enrollment?
Children must be 5 years old by September 1st to enroll in our kindergarten program. We assess each child individually to ensure readiness for our program.
How does Reach Academy's kindergarten prepare students for first grade?
Our kindergarten curriculum exceeds Texas state standards, ensuring children develop strong foundations in literacy, numeracy, critical thinking, and social skills. The individualized nature of our A.C.E. program allows each child to progress at their optimal pace, preparing them thoroughly for the academic demands of first grade.
What makes your kindergarten program different from public school options near Independence Parkway?
Unlike public schools, we integrate faith throughout our curriculum, maintain small class sizes for personalized attention, and follow the A.C.E. model that allows children to progress at their own pace rather than being locked into grade-level constraints. Additionally, our teachers can freely discuss God, pray with students, and teach from a biblical worldview.
